Friday just wasn't the day for Wakefield's offense. They were outmatched by the Axtell Eagles and fell 46-0. The defeat leaves the Bombers still looking for their first win of the season.
Wakefield's loss dropped their record down to 0-5. As for Axtell, their win bumped their record up to 5-0.
Looking ahead, Wakefield will be playing in front of their home fans against Hanover at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. The Bombers will need to watch out since the Wildcats have now posted at least 31 points every time they've taken the field this season. As for Axtell, they will venture away from home to face off against St. Paul at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. The Eagles will be up against the Indians' rather soft defense (which has allowed 42.6 points per matchup), so fans could be in store for a big offensive performance.
